What is a fracture caused by torsional forces?

What is a fracture caused by torsional forces?

A spiral fracture, also known as torsion fracture, is a type of complete fracture. It occurs due to a rotational, or twisting, force.

What is a torsion break?

Torsion fracture: A fracture, also called a spiral fracture, in which a bone has been twisted apart.

Can you break your arm by twisting it?

Spiral fractures are a type of broken bone. They happen when one of your bones is broken with a twisting motion. They create a fracture line that wraps around your bone and looks like a corkscrew. You might see spiral fractures referred to as complete fractures.

What is torsion stress?

Torsional stress can be defined as the shear stress that acts on a transverse cross section which is caused by the action of a twist. Torsional shear stress can be thought of as the shear stress produced on a shaft due to twisting.

What is a depressed skull?

A depressed skull fracture is a break in a cranial bone (or “crushed” portion of skull) with depression of the bone in toward the brain. A compound fracture involves a break in, or loss of, skin and splintering of the bone.

What is an example of torsion force?

A screwdriver used to twist a screw into place has a shaft that is undergoing a torsion force. Suspension bridges can be subjected to torsion forces when gusts of wind blow them back and forth. Drive shafts, or any type of shaft subjected to circumferential motion, can be exposed to torsion forces.

What is shaft fatigue?

Fatigue is among the most common cause of failure of such shafts. Fatigue failures start at the most vulnerable point in a dynamically stressed area particularly where there is a stress raiser [1]. The stress raiser may be mechanical or metallurgical in nature, or sometimes a combination of the two.
